NEW YORK, November 21, 2023 – Investors are reassessing DigitalBridge group after a downgrade from Truist Financial following SoftBank’s acquisition of a significant stake in the digital infrastructure investment firm. The stock was downgraded to Hold from Buy, signaling caution amid the changing ownership landscape.

Truist Cites Integration Concerns
Truist analysts expressed concerns about the potential challenges of integrating SoftBank’s vision with DigitalBridge’s existing strategy. The acquisition of a 12.5% stake by SoftBank’s Vision Fund 2 introduces a new dynamic, prompting a reassessment of the company’s future prospects. The analysts noted that SoftBank’s involvement could lead to changes in DigitalBridge’s operational focus and financial performance.
Stock Reaction and Analyst Commentary
Following the announcement of SoftBank’s investment, DigitalBridge’s stock price experienced noticeable volatility. While the initial reaction was positive, the downgrade from Truist has introduced a degree of uncertainty. The analysts emphasized that SoftBank’s track record of large-scale investments and subsequent strategic shifts warrants a cautious approach.
